NXP evaluation boards are hardware tools that enable developers to experiment with, test, and prototype applications using NXP's microcontrollers, processors or other semiconductor components. They offer convenient access to essential chip features such as I/O interfaces, automotive communication protocols and power management features, making it easier to assess system performance before building custom hardware. Among these, FRDM Automotive development boards are recognized for being cost-effective, compact and scalable through add-on expansion boards, ideal for quick prototyping and educational use. Though they offer essential features for embedded development in combination with scalability options through expansion boards, they are more streamlined than other NXP Evaluation Kits (EVKs), which tend to be larger and more feature rich to support advanced, in-depth evaluation. FRDM Automotive development boards offer Real Time Drivers (RTD) software supporting both AUTOSAR and non-AUTOSAR (similar to traditional SDKs) applications. Both are ISO 26262 functional safety compliant up to ASIL D.
A wide range of standard low-level drivers (LLD) and complex device drivers (CDD) create a rich ecosystem integrated into a unified development environment with highly optimized code. Each driver provides two sets of APIs: one compliant with AUTOSAR and the other directly accessing the hardware. For a non-AUTOSAR application, any interface can be used, according to the scope of the application.
